Parse-ServerParse-Server is recommended for startups, small to medium enterprises, and individual developers seeking a cost-effective backend solution with full control over their infrastructure. It's also ideal for projects that require rapid prototyping and deployment, app developers who need pre-built SDKs, and teams looking to migrate away from Parse's legacy hosted services.

Most wine apps recommend popular bottles or generic pairings. WineIQ starts with the wines you already own. It remembers whatโs in your cellar, learns your taste, and gives personalised advice based on what you can actually drink tonight.
